#681255 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#681255 is composed of 40.8% red, 7.1% green and 33.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 82.7% magenta, 18.3% yellow and 59.2% black. It has a hue angle of 313.3 degrees, a saturation of 70.5% and a lightness of 23.9%. #681255 color hex could be obtained by blending #d024aa with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#660066.

● #681255 color description : Very dark magenta.
#681255 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#681255 has RGB values of R:104, G:18, B:85 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.83, Y:0.18, K:0.59. Its decimal value is 6820437.
